Act VI - An entire universe lies between a proof of concept and a luxury watch. Enter Bruno Moutarlier, former industrial director of Audemars Piguet and a pillar of the brand’s success in the first decade of the millennium. HYT has its man capable of managing the situation. To develop the movement for the future H1, Bruno Moutarlier turns to Jean-François Mojon and his team at Chronode. For the liquid part, he advises Lucien Vouillamoz who pilots the reliability trials and the production, in conjunction with Helbling Technik. Then, Xavier Casals, close to Vincent Perriard for 15 years, who has followed all its watchmaking adventures, starting with Audemars Piguet from 1995 – 2000, joins HYT as Artistic Director. Meanwhile, CEO and HYT partner Vincent Perriard entrusts the design of the future H1 to the Etude de Style design company, headed by Sébastien Perret, which is already working on the H2, H3 and H4.
